Ingredients
To make these delicious chocolate peanut butter no-bake cookies, you will need the following ingredients:
– 2 cups of granulated sugar
– 1/2 cup of milk
– 1/2 cup of unsalted butter
– 1/4 cup of unsweetened cocoa powder
– 1/2 cup of creamy peanut butter
– 3 cups of quick-cooking oats
– 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ract
Make sure to gather all the ingredients before you start preparing the cookies to ensure a smooth cooking process.
Steps
Follow these simple steps to make the perfect batch of chocolate peanut butter no-bake cookies:
Step 1: Prepare the Ingredients
Start by measuring out all the ingredients as listed in the recipe. Having everything prepped and ready to go will make the cooking process much easier.
Step 2: Combine Sugar, Milk, Butter, and Cocoa
In a saucepan, combine the sugar, milk, butter, and cocoa powder over medium heat. Stir the mixture continuously until the butter melts and the sugar dissolves.
Step 3: Boil the Mixture
Once the mixture comes to a boil, let it cook for about one minute, stirring constantly to prevent burning.
Step 4: Add Peanut Butter, Oats, and Vanilla
Remove the saucepan from the heat and stir in the peanut butter, quick-cooking oats, and vanilla extract. Mix everything together until well combined.
Step 5: Form Cookies
Drop spoonfuls of the cookie mixture onto wax paper or a baking sheet. Let the cookies cool and set for about 30 minutes before serving.
Variations
While the classic chocolate peanut butter no-bake cookies are delicious on their own, you can always get creative and try out some variations to suit your taste preferences. Here are a few ideas to switch things up:
1. Add Nuts
You can add chopped nuts such as almonds, walnuts, or pecans to give your cookies an extra crunch and nutty flavor.
2. Use Different Nut Butter
Experiment with different nut butter options like almond butter or cashew butter for a unique twist on the traditional recipe.
3. Sprinkle Sea Salt
Sprinkle a pinch of sea salt on top of the cookies before they set to enhance the flavors and add a touch of sophistication.
4. Drizzle with Chocolate
For an extra chocolatey treat, drizzle melted chocolate over the cooled cookies for a decadent finish.
Tips
Here are some helpful tips to ensure your chocolate peanut butter no-bake cookies turn out perfect every time:
1. Use Fresh Ingredients
Make sure your ingredients are fresh and of good quality to enhance the flavor of the cookies.
2. Don’t Overcook the Mixture
Be cautious not to overcook the sugar and butter mixture as it can result in dry and crumbly cookies.
3. Store Properly
Store the cookies in an airtight container at room temperature to maintain their freshness and texture.
4. Double the Recipe
If you’re making these cookies for a larger crowd, feel free to double the recipe to ensure there’s enough for everyone to enjoy.

FAQs
Q: Can I use natural peanut butter for this recipe?
A: While natural peanut butter can be used, keep in mind that it may alter the texture and flavor of the cookies slightly. Stick to creamy peanut butter for best results.
Q: How long do these cookies last?
A: When stored properly in an airtight container, these cookies can last for up to a week. However, they are best enjoyed fresh within the first few days.
Q: Can I freeze these cookies?
A: Yes, you can freeze these cookies for up to 2-3 months. Thaw them at room temperature before serving for the best taste and texture.
Q: Can I omit the cocoa powder for a peanut butter-only version?
A: While the cocoa powder adds a rich chocolate flavor to the cookies, you can omit it if you prefer a peanut butter-only version. Just increase the amount of peanut butter slightly for a more pronounced flavor.
